How do you use a kimchee base?
Either add the kimchee base as a sauce when stir frying meat or noodles, toss through cold vegetables to make a delicately spiced salad. Also use instead of kimchi juice when making tofu jiggae, a spicy Korean tofu-based stew.

Does kimchi base need to be refrigerated?
Once opened, kimchi should be refrigerated to help it last longer. Kimchi is not considered shelf stable because of its numerous healthy bacteria, so you shouldn’t keep it at room temperature. What is kimchi topping?
It’s a simple combination of red pepper flakes, garlic, ginger, sugar, lime juice, water, salt, and fish sauce, but the easiest way to get it is to buy it at Korean grocers and Asian specialty markets, where it’s often labeled as kimchi base. It’s punchy and sharp, tangy, and incredibly invigorating.

Can you use gochugaru for kimchi?
The coarse grind of Korean chili powder (gochugaru) is used in Kimchi and many Korean side dishes. It has a flake-like consistency. The fine grind of Korean chili powder is used to make Gochujang, a red sauce used much like American ketchup.
Does homemade kimchi need to be refrigerated?
Kimchi should be stored in the fridge as chilling is the only thing that keeps its level of fermentation (i.e. the activity of those happy little probiotics) slowed down. If you leave kimchi outside of the fridge, over time it will become over-fermented and won’t taste so great anymore.

What is kimchi traditionally eaten with?
In Korea, kimchi can be served as a main dish or a side dish with rice, noodles, or soup. Some of the most popular dishes ordered at Korean restaurants include kimchijeon (kimchi pancakes), kimchi jjigae (kimchi stew), and budae jjigae (army stew).
